Japanese e-commerce giant Rakuten may have just hired its India head

http://yourstory.com/2016/06/rakuten-india-entry/Sachin Dalal, Co-founder of BSE listed company Infibeam, is all set to spearhead Japanese e-commerce giant Rakuten’s entry into India. According to a report by The Economic Times, Dalal joined the company earlier this month and will be taking on the likes of Amazon and Flipkart. Earlier this week, Rakuten had announced exiting global markets including geographies like UK, Austria and Spain, due to weak growth prospects.

The company opened its development centre in Bengaluru in 2014. Reports mention that soon after the launch of development centre, Rakuten started to poach mid-level managers from Flipkart and Amazon in India. Rakuten plans to start its marketplace in India by next year.

In July 2014, the Japanese Internet giant, which is among the top 10 Internet companies globally in terms of revenue, launched a $100 million global investment fund, Rakuten Ventures, focusing on startups in Israel, US and APAC region. Rakuten is known for its investments in US-based ride hailing app Lyft and online scrapbooking site Pinterest. Via yourstory.com

Freecharge will not go the cashback way: CEO Rajan

http://www.business-standard.com/article/companies/freecharge-will-not-go-the-cashback-way-ceo-rajan-116053100311_1.htmlPayments platform Freecharge would not use cashbacks to win against Paytm and Mobikwik, said its new chief executive Govind Rajan. “Promotions only draw the first set of customers. After that, it is the fact that it takes just about 10 seconds to complete a transaction that will keep them with us,” he said.

Rajan was nonchalant that other service providers like Paytm were using cashbacks to retain customers. “Promotions are not the right way to build sticky customers,” he pointed out and added promoted transactions received just 20 per cent of the traffic on Freecharge.

Rajan said Freecharge was conducting one million transactions a day and was targeting seven million by the end of 2016-17. Freecharge has seen a fourfold increase in the number of transactions since its acquisition by Snapdeal and subsequent launch as a wallet in October. Via business-standard.com

Are cashbacks predatory pricing? CCI to vet sops given by online payment platforms

http://www.bullfax.com/?q=node-are-cashbacks-predatory-pricing-cci-vet-sops-given-onliIndia’s competition watchdog has formed an in-house expert panel to ascertain whether the cashback incentives offered by digital wallets and e-tailers on recharges, bill payments or purchase of other products constitute predatory pricing. Digital wallets and e-commerce companies such as Paytm and Mobikwik often offer cashback incentives to users making payments through them.

“A panel has been formed by the Competition Commission of India (CCI) that is studying the cashback model being used by online payment platforms, e-commerce companies and also several banks,” a senior CCI official told ET, requesting not to be identified. The official said the move follows several complaints received by the commission on such offers.

“This is a new market that we need to understand since we get a lot of complaints related to it,” he said. The panel is likely to complete its study and give its opinion within a couple of months. “It has to be ascertained whether the cashback offers are being offered to create a new market by incentivising customers or to disrupt the competition in the existing market through predatory pricing,” the official said. Locally developed cashback app hits 130,000 downloads

SnapNSaveSNAPnSAVE, a Cape Town based start-up that gives shoppers cash back on everyday shopping items, simply for snapping their till slip, has grown to 130,000 users and paid back over R500,000 ($33,670) in cash.

Locally developed cashback app hits 130,000 downloadsIt has gained its rapid success organically, without massive marketing campaigns, which can be attributed to its simplicity. Users purchase featured items from any major retailer and then get cash back by snapping a photo of their till slip.

The success is a testament that South Africans are looking for ways to help ease the burden on already overstretched wallets. Mark Bradshaw, SnapnSave CEO says, “Mobile coupons are booming in South Africa. Unlike some of the big loyalty programmes, the benefit with this app is that shoppers can save no matter where they shop.”

The app has been ranked the #1 shopping app in the Apple store and the #1 lifestyle app in Google Play Store. Via bizcommunity.com

FreeShipping.com Is Giving Online Shoppers 20% Cash Back at 30 Top Retailers All Memorial Day Weekend

FreeShipping-tabletFreeShipping.com, a leading online shopping program, will offer new and current members 20% cash back on their purchases at 30 of the most popular stores in its vast retailer network over Memorial Day weekend. The 20% cash-back offer will last from 12:00 a.m. on Friday, May 27, through 11:59 p.m. on Monday, May 30.

The 30 retailers where FreeShipping.com members can earn 20% cash back for four straight days include American Eagle, Disney Store, Home Depot, Kohl’s, P.C. Richard & Son, Macy’s, and two dozen other shoppers’ favorites.
